Description

The Omaha Beach Memorial is a poignant memorial commemorating the most tragic Allied landing on June 6, 1944. The 1,400 m² museum displays authentic artifacts, weapons, and documents from "Bloody Omaha," where more than 4,000 American soldiers lost their lives.

A unique Navy SEALs monument with granite panels and a sculpture of a sapper pays tribute to the units that cleared the beach of obstacles. The exhibition shows the American and German perspectives and human stories of heroism, including the contribution of Native Americans.
